Royer Labs SF-12 is a passive stereo coincident ribbon microphone — two matched 1.8-micron aluminum ribbon elements mounted one above the other in a true Blumlein configuration (crossed figure-eights, 45 degrees off center) within a single ingot iron body. The SF-12 is fully passive: the absence of any active electronics eliminates any internal overload point, maintaining full frequency response all the way to the maximum SPL rating of above 130 dB. Each of the two transducers uses a proprietary crossfield motor assembly: four Neodymium magnets with Permendur iron pole pieces minimize the front-to-rear acoustic path length, extending the high-frequency ceiling without artificial boost. The ingot iron body forms part of the magnetic return circuit, actively containing stray flux — the source of the microphone's relatively high sensitivity for such a compact package. The SF-12 design originates with Bob Speiden; Royer produces it with upgraded toroidal transformers, a lower-mass ribbon, and improved transducer mechanics.
Crossfield motor and ingot iron body — the physics behind the SF-12's sound
A stereo ribbon setup built from two separate microphones — on a stereo bar or in separate housings — always introduces a small but measurable spacing between capsules. The SF-12 is genuinely coincident: both elements occupy the same acoustic point, eliminating inter-channel time-of-arrival differences and producing stereo imaging that collapses to mono without artifacts. The crossfield motor in each transducer — four Neodymium magnets with Permendur pole pieces — shortens the front-to-rear acoustic path to the minimum achievable, directly extending the high-frequency response while maintaining the flat characteristic of a well-designed ribbon. The 1.8-micron ribbons, each weighing approximately one-third of a milligram, deliver transient response comparable to a condenser microphone. Negligible off-axis coloration means the SF-12 maintains consistent character regardless of the angle of incoming sound — critical when miking wide sections or ensembles where sources span a broad horizontal arc.
Recording configurations and mono operation
The SF-12 supports two configurations from a single mic position: classic Blumlein and M/S — the latter requiring only matrix processing in the console or DAW, enabling post-session stereo width adjustment without moving the microphone. The lower element corresponds to the left channel and the upper to the right, referenced from behind the microphone. Phase compatibility between the two channels is complete — summing to mono creates no artifacts. Either element can be used independently as a standalone mono figure-eight microphone. As a passive design, the SF-12 requires a high-gain, high-input-impedance preamplifier; its sensitivity of above -52 dBv is at passive ribbon levels, which distinguishes it clearly from the active SF-24. The extension cable terminates in a Y-splitter to two 3-pin XLR connectors labeled Upper and Lower. TECHNICAL SPECIFICATIONS
- Acoustic operating principle: electrodynamic pressure gradient (passive)
- Polar pattern: symmetrical figure-8 (Blumlein)
- Generating element: 1.8-micron aluminum ribbon (99.99% Al)
- Motor assembly: crossfield — 4x Neodymium magnets + Permendur iron pole pieces per transducer
- Frequency response: 30–15,000 Hz +/- 3 dB
- Sensitivity: above -52 dBv re. 1V/Pa
- Output impedance: 300 ohms @ 1 kHz (nominal)
- Rated load impedance: above 1,500 ohms
- Maximum SPL: above 130 dB
- Output connector: XLR 5-pin (stereo)
- Dimensions: 206 mm (L) x 25 mm (W)
- Weight: 369 g (13 oz)
- Finish: Matte Black Chrome; optional Dull Satin Nickel
